I have two Oscellaris Clowns. A female about 1.5" long and a male about 1". They have been together for about 9 months and host in a healthy bubbletip that they've had for 9 months.

Today I saw the female cleaning the rock with her mouth under the anemone. I've heard this is often a pre spawning behavior.

If so,

I'd love recommendations on what to watch for and or do if they lay eggs.

I am not set up to put the eggs in another tank right now, but perhaps if they start spawning regularly I will invest in a tank to raise the young.


Any advice appreciated.

Mine usually lay eggs within one hour of lights off every 7-9 days. Cleaning behavior could be signs pre spawning. After the female lays eggs. The next day I feed extra Mysis/brine shrimp for extra protein.
